It is cycling for Samajwadi Party on yoga day
Team Udayavani, Jun 21, 2017, 2:05 PM IST
Lucknow: The Samajwadi Party today celebrated the International Day of Yoga day by undertaking ‘cycle yatras’ across the state.
Directives were issued to partymen by SP National President Akhilesh Yadav to take out cycle yatra at all district headquarter from 6 am and later perform yoga as per their convenience at their homes.
The party’s move has been seen as a counter to BJP’s yoga day programme in Lucknow in which Prime Minister Narendra Modi participated along with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ath.
“On directions of SP National President Akhilesh Yadav cycle yatras were taken out in the district headquarters by respective presidents and party office bearers on International Day of Yoga to give a message of environment conservation and health awareness”, SP spokesman Rajendra Chowdhury said.
Cycle is the election symbol of the Samajwadi Party.
Though Akhilesh has been extended an invitation by the Yogi government for the event in the city, he did not turn up at the venue.
When the SP was in power, it had shunned official celebrations on this day.
